Olivia Monologue from Mr. Pim Passes By: A Comedy in Three Acts

From Mr. Pim Passes By: A Comedy in Three Acts by A. A. (Alan Alexander) Milne

female · comedic · 48 sec

Then, seeing that we can't both be in it, it looks as though you'd have to turn me out. (To herself.) There must be legal ways of doing these things. You'd have to consult your solicitor again. (GEORGE: Legal ways?) Well, you couldn't just throw me out, could you? You'd have to get an injunction against me-- (GEORGE, very annoyed, turns away.) --or prosecute me for trespass--or something. Of course I shouldn't go if I could help it, I like the house so much.... It would make an awfully unusual case, wouldn't it? The papers would be full of it.
